Your Chiropractic Office Discusses 5 Ways To Feed Your Brain


How often do you feed your brain? Think about it? Do you read, eat healthy and exercise?
Research has shown that the capacity of the average person’s brain outweighs what they use it for. The human brain cell can hold five-times as much information as the Encyclopedia Britannica. But do we educate it enough? Do we get it ready for our life race? Do we train it, exercise it?

Here are 5 ways you can exercise that wonderful brain of yours:
1. Exercise helps to increase brain function and enhances neurogenesis. Guess What? Every time you exercise you are creating new brain cells! More reason to stay fit!
2. Think Positive it helps to lower stress! The science of thinking positive is called neuroplasticity. It means that our thoughts can change the function and structure of our brains. Happy Brain=Happy Life!
3. Read a book or whatever you can get your hands on. It helps feed the brain and use your imagination. Education + Imagination = Creativity!
4. Training memory is a great way to work out your precious brain. Just like training for a marathon it is essential to test your memorizing skills. Try memorizing phone numbers and birthdays to start!
5. Eat healthy to impact your brain. According to Oregon State University’s Linus Pauling Institute, proper nutrition is essential for normal cognition, or thinking skills. Think low fat and high in nutrients!
